Basic Information

Product Name 2-Methyl-5-(3-Piperidinylmethoxy)Pyridine
CAS No. 914299-47-1
Molecular Formula C12H18N2O
Molecular Weight 206.29 g/mol
Synonyms 5-[(3-Piperidinyl)methoxy]-2-picoline; 2-Methyl-5-[(piperidin-3-yl)methoxy]pyridine; 2-Picoline, 5-[(3-piperidinyl)methoxy]-; 914299-47-1; 3-((6-Methylpyridin-3-yl)oxy)methyl)piperidine
